How Do I Make Pictures Private On Facebook
Approach 1: Making a Solitary Picture Private on Facebook
1. Open Facebook. Most likely to https://www.facebook.com/ in your browser. This will certainly open your News Feed if you're logged into Facebook.
- If you aren't logged right into Facebook, enter your e-mail address as well as password to do so.
2. Most likely to your account. Click your name in the top-right side of the Facebook web page.
3. Click the Photos tab. You'll discover this below the cover photo that's at the top of your Facebook page.
4. Select a photo category. Click a category tab (e.g., Your Images) near the top of the web page.
5. Select a photo. Click a picture that you wish to make private. This will open the photo.
- The picture must be one that you published, not simply one of you that someone else posted.
6. Click the "Privacy" symbol. This symbol normally appears like a silhouette of a person (or more people) that you'll locate listed below and to the right of your name in the upper-right side of the picture. A drop-down menu will certainly appear.
- If clicking this symbol leads to a menu that claims Edit Post Privacy, click Edit Post Privacy to head to the post, after that click the privacy symbol at the top of the post prior to proceeding.
7. Click More ... It's in the drop-down menu.
8. Click Only Me. This option remains in the increased drop-down menu. Doing so will instantly change your picture's privacy to make sure that only you could see it.
Approach 2: Making a Cd Private on Facebook
1. Click your name in the Facebook display's top ideal edge to open your account.
2. Click the "Photos" link to open up the Photos and Videos page.
3. Click an album to open it.
4. Float your mouse cursor over the symbol to the right of the album's name. Text appears specifying the album's present privacy setup. As an example, the album could have a globe icon and also the setup "Public".
5. Click the icon to open up a drop-down menu.
6. Click "Only Me" to hide the album.
